Journal of Phonetics | 2010

The role of syllable structure in external sandhi: An EPG study of vocalisation and retraction in word-final English /l/

James M. Scobbie; Marianne Pouplier

A pre-vocalic connected speech context is said to enable the resyllabification of word-final consonants into an onset, thus conditioning alternations. We present EPG data on English word-final /l/, measuring the extent of alveolar contact and the rate of vocalisation, the extent of dorsal retraction (representing “darkness”), and the timing of alveolar contact relative to dorsal retraction. Two dialects of British English are considered, namely Scottish Standard English and Southern Standard British English. Results are that /l/ alternation is systematic: the tongue tip contact of word-final /l/, quite categorically for some speakers, is more onset-like in pre-vocalic and more coda-like in pre-consonantal contexts. This alternation is not along the lines predicted by a segmental resyllabification account, however. First, the segmental identity of the following consonant (/b/ or /h/) may be as powerful a factor in conditioning the presence or absence of alveolar contact for some speakers. Second, glottalisation of lexically vowel-initial words regularly occurs, but does not seem to condition the appearance (or otherwise) of tongue tip contact. Third, the tongue dorsum remains retracted and does not adopt an onset-like form or timing even when /l/ is pre-vocalic. Thus categorical resyllabification of a word-final /l/ segment based on phonotactic acceptability is rejected as a mechanism controlling English L-sandhi in connected speech. Instead, we propose a gestural-episodic model, in which individual gestures display different levels of coherence in lexical syllable roles, while in connected speech, segmental sequences are influenced by similarity to well-rehearsed lexical sequences, if they exist.


Clinical Linguistics & Phonetics | 2015

Using ultrasound visual biofeedback to treat persistent primary speech sound disorders

Joanne Cleland; James M. Scobbie; Alan Wrench

Abstract Growing evidence suggests that speech intervention using visual biofeedback may benefit people for whom visual skills are stronger than auditory skills (for example, the hearing-impaired population), especially when the target articulation is hard to describe or see. Diagnostic ultrasound can be used to image the tongue and has recently become more compact and affordable leading to renewed interest in it as a practical, non-invasive visual biofeedback tool. In this study, we evaluate its effectiveness in treating children with persistent speech sound disorders that have been unresponsive to traditional therapy approaches. A case series of seven different children (aged 6–11) with persistent speech sound disorders were evaluated. For each child, high-speed ultrasound (121 fps), audio and lip video recordings were made while probing each child’s specific errors at five different time points (before, during and after intervention). After intervention, all the children made significant progress on targeted segments, evidenced by both perceptual measures and changes in tongue-shape.


Second Language Research | 2010

Measuring language-specific phonetic settings

Ineke Mennen; James M. Scobbie; Esther de Leeuw; Sonja Schaeffler; Felix Schaeffler

While it is well known that languages have different phonemes and phonologies, there is growing interest in the idea that languages may also differ in their ‘phonetic setting’. The term ‘phonetic setting’ refers to a tendency to make the vocal apparatus employ a language-specific habitual configuration. For example, languages may differ in their degree of lip-rounding, tension of the lips and tongue, jaw position, phonation types, pitch range and register. Such phonetic specifications may be particularly difficult for second language (L2) learners to acquire, yet be easily perceivable by first language (L1) listeners as inappropriate. Techniques that are able to capture whether and how an L2 learner’s pronunciation proficiency in their two languages relates to the respective phonetic settings in each language should prove useful for second language research. This article gives an overview of a selection of techniques that can be used to investigate phonetic settings at the articulatory level, such as flesh-point tracking, ultrasound tongue imaging and electropalatography (EPG), as well as a selection of acoustic measures such as measures of pitch range, long-term average spectra and formants.


Journal of Phonetics | 2013

Bunched /r/ promotes vowel merger to schwar: an ultrasound tongue imaging study of Scottish sociophonetic variation

Eleanor Lawson; James M. Scobbie; Jane Stuart-Smith

For a century, phoneticians have noted a vowel merger in middle-class Scottish English, in the neutralisation of prerhotic checked vowels /ɪ/, /ʌ/, /ɛ/ to a central vowel, e.g. fir, fur, fern [fəɹ], [fəɹ] [fəɹn], or [fɚ], [fɚ], [fɚn]. Working-class speakers often neutralise two of these checked vowels to a low back [ʌ] vowel, fir, fur, both pronounced as [fʌɹ] or as [fʌʕ]. The middle-class merger is often assumed to be an adaptation towards the UK’s socially prestigious R.P. phonological system in which there is a long-standing three-way non-rhotic merger, to [ɜː]. However, we suggest a system-internal cause, that coarticulation with the postvocalic /r/ may play a role in the contemporary Scottish vowel merger. Indeed, strongly rhotic middle-class Scottish speakers have recently been found to produce postvocalic approximant /r/ using a markedly different tongue configuration from working-class Scottish speakers, who also tend to derhoticise /r/. We present the results of an ultrasound tongue imaging investigation into the differing coarticulatory effects of bunched and tongue-front raised /r/ variants on preceding vowels. We compare tongue shapes from two static points during rhotic syllable rimes. Phonetically, it appears that the bunched /r/ used by middle-class speakers exerts a stronger global coarticulatory force over preceding vowel tongue configurations than tongue-front raised /r/ does. This also results in a monophthongal rhotic target for what historically had been three distinct checked vowels. Phonologically, our view is that middle-class speakers of Scottish English have reduced the V+/r/ sequence to one segment; either a rhoticised vowel /ɚ/ or a syllabic rhotic /r/.


Clinical Linguistics & Phonetics | 2004

Advances in EPG for treatment and research: an illustrative case study.

James M. Scobbie; Sara Wood; Alan Wrench

Electropalatography (EPG), a technique which reveals tongue‐palate contact patterns over time, is a highly effective tool for speech research. We report here on recent developments by Articulate Instruments Ltd. These include hardware for Windows‐based computers, backwardly compatible (with Reading EPG3) software systems for clinical intervention and laboratory‐based analysis for EPG and acoustic data, and an enhanced clinical interface with client and file management tools. We focus here on a single case study of a child aged 10± years who had been diagnosed with an intractable speech disorder possibly resulting ultimately from a complete cleft of hard and soft palate. We illustrate how assessment, diagnosis and treatment of the intractable speech disorder are undertaken using this new generation of instrumental phonetic support. We also look forward to future developments in articulatory phonetics that will link EPG with ultrasound for research and clinical communities.


International Journal of Bilingualism | 2012

Singing a different tune in your native language: first language attrition of prosody.

Esther de Leeuw; Ineke Mennen; James M. Scobbie

First language attrition refers to the changes which a first language (L1) undergoes when a second language (L2) is acquired in a context in which L1 use is reduced (Cook, 2003; Köpke, 2004). To date, some studies have focused on complete loss of an L1, for example in the case of children whose contact with their initial language ceased after adoption (Pallier et al., 2003; Ventureyra, Pallier, & Yoo, 2004). Others have investigated more subtle cases in which changes to the L1 occur, although intelligibility remains largely, or completely, unaffected (de Leeuw, Schmid, & Mennen, 2007; Flege, 1987; Flege & Eefting, 1987; Major, 1992; Mennen, 2004). The study at hand belongs to the latter category, comprising a fine phonetic analysis of prosody in 10 late consecutive German–English bilinguals. In general, the results indicate L1 attrition in the intonational alignment of the prenuclear rise. However, interpersonal variation was also evidenced: two bilinguals performed clearly within the English monolingual norm in their German while one bilingual evidenced no L1 attrition. Intrapersonal variation occurred in the form of the start of the prenuclear rise appearing to undergo more L1 attrition than the end. The results are discussed in relation to previous studies suggesting that L1 attrition is less likely to occur in late consecutive bilinguals than in early consecutive bilinguals and, more generally, with regard to transfer and interference.


Encyclopedia of Language & Linguistics (Second Edition) | 2006

R) as a Variable

James M. Scobbie

All sounds are variable, but some are more variable than others. Does hyper-variation mean a greater disposition for sociolinguistically relevant conditioning, or, alternatively, a tendency for relatively greater noisiness in the distribution of unconditioned variants? Whatever the case, there should clearly be a special interest in the sociolinguistic systemization of those sounds that are so unusually prone to variation that it is difficult to capture them within a simple articulatory and acoustic definition. Such is the case with the sociolinguistic variable (R).


International Journal of Bilingualism | 2013

Dynamic systems, maturational constraints and L1 phonetic attrition

Esther de Leeuw; Ineke Mennen; James M. Scobbie

The present study comprises a phonetic analysis of the lateral phoneme /l/ in the first (L1) and second language (L2) of 10 late German–English bilinguals. The primary objective of the study was to compare the predictive power of dynamic systems theory with that of maturational constraints through a phonetic investigation of L1 attrition in the lateral phoneme /l/ of the late bilinguals. The results revealed L1 attrition in the lateral phoneme /l/, as well as a high degree of interpersonal and intrapersonal variation. These patterns are discussed in relation to dynamic systems theory and maturational constraints. Moreover, the degree of permanency of L1 attrition is discussed in relation to methodological considerations in studies on L1 attrition. It is proposed that maturational constraints are insufficient in explaining the results and that bilingual language development can be more adequately explained through dynamic systems theory, which explicitly incorporates a multitude of predictor variables across the lifespan, in addition to age constraints.


Archive | 2014

A Socio-Articulatory Study of Scottish Rhoticity

Eleanor Lawson; James M. Scobbie; Jane Stuart-Smith

Increasing attention is being paid in sociolinguistics to how fine phonetic variation is exploited by speakers to construct and index social identity (Hay and Drager 2007). To date, most sociophonetic work on consonants has made use of acoustic analysis to reveal unexpectedly subtle variation which is nonetheless socially indexical (e.g. Docherty and Foulkes 1999). However, some aspects of speech production are not readily recoverable even with a fine-grained acoustic analysis. New articulatory analysis techniques, such as ultrasound tongue imaging (UTI), allow researchers to push the boundaries further, identifying seemingly covert aspects of speech articulation which pattern with indexical factors with remarkable consistency. One such case is postvocalic /r/ variation in Central Scotland.


Clinical Linguistics & Phonetics | 2013

Tongue reading : comparing the interpretation of visual information from inside the mouth, from electropalatographic and ultrasound displays of speech sounds

Joanne Cleland; Caitlin McCron; James M. Scobbie

Speakers possess a natural capacity for lip reading; analogous to this, there may be an intuitive ability to “tongue-read.” Although the ability of untrained participants to perceive aspects of the speech signal has been explored for some visual representations of the vocal tract (e.g. talking heads), it is not yet known to what extent there is a natural ability to interpret speech information presented through two clinical phonetic tools: EPG and ultrasound. This study aimed to determine whether there is any intuitive ability to interpret the images produced by these systems, and to determine whether one tool is more conducive to this than the other. Twenty adults viewed real-time and slow motion EPG and ultrasound silent movies of 10 different linguo-palatal consonants and 4 vowels. Participants selected which segment they perceived from four forced-choice options. Overall, participants scored above chance in the EPG and ultrasound conditions, suggesting that these images can be interpreted intuitively to some degree. This was the case for consonants in both the conditions and for vowels in the EPG condition.
